In the vast and often chaotic world of financial literature, few texts manage to transcend their medium to achieve the status of a practical manual for professional traders. Linda Raschke’s Street Smarts: High Probability Short-Term Trading Strategies , co-authored with Laurence Connors, is one such text. For decades, aspiring traders have scoured the internet for a "verified" copy of this book, often seeking a PDF version to immediately access its wisdom. The search for a "verified" PDF highlights a crucial aspect of the trading community: the hunger for legitimate, battle-tested strategies in an industry rife with scams and theoretical fluff. This essay examines the enduring relevance of Street Smarts , analyzing why its principles remain a gold standard and why the integrity of its strategies—verified by decades of market data—continues to appeal to the modern speculator. Co-authored by two legendary traders, Linda Bradford Raschke and Laurence A. Connors, this 1996 classic has become one of the most cited and controversial works in the trading world. It stands as a testament to the fact that market wisdom doesn't age and that genuine "street smarts" will always outperform over-optimized algorithms.
